Custer Creek Farms Homes Market Snapshot
Updated May 2026
2 Active Homes for Sale
$2,195,000 Median List Price
$466 Average Price Per Sq. Ft.
54 Average Days on Market

Custer Creek Farms Location and Lifestyle
Custer Creek Farms offers a Frisco location many buyers want. It provides access to business centers, shopping, dining, schools, parks, and major roads. At the same time, it keeps the feel of a spacious luxury residential community.
Nearby destinations include Legacy West, The Shops at Legacy, Stonebriar Country Club, Arbor Hills Nature Preserve, Dallas North Tollway, and major Frisco destinations throughout the surrounding area.
Families also value access to Frisco Independent School District. Nearby private school options include St. Mark’s School of Texas, Hockaday School, and Ursuline Academy.
The neighborhood also offers access to major North Dallas destinations. These include Dallas Love Field Airport, UT Southwestern, NorthPark Center, Preston Center, and Dallas.
